1.1 A bill for an act 1.2 relating to school buses; limiting authority to 1.3 operate certain school buses without a school bus 1.4 endorsement; amending Minnesota Statutes 2000, section 1.5 171.321, subdivision 1. 1.6 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F MINNESOTA: 1.7 Section 1. Minnesota Statutes 2000, section 171.321, 1.8 subdivision 1, is amended to read: 1.9 Subdivision 1. [ENDORSEMENT.] (a) No person shall drive a 1.10 school bus when transporting school children to or from school 1.11 or upon a school-related trip or activity without having a valid 1.12 class A, class B, or class C driver's license with a school bus 1.13 endorsementexcept that. 1.14 (b) Notwithstanding paragraph (a), a person possessing a 1.15 valid driver's license but not a school bus endorsement may 1.16 drive a vehicle with a seating capacity of ten or less persons 1.17 used as a school bus but not outwardly equipped or identified as 1.18 a school bus, for transportation other than scheduled 1.19 transportation of students to and from school.
